lib/rubocop/directive_comment.rb
# frozen_string_literal: true
module RuboCop
# This class wraps the `Parser::Source::Comment` object that represents a
# special `rubocop:disable` and `rubocop:enable` comment and exposes what
# cops it contains.
class DirectiveComment
# @api private
LINT_DEPARTMENT = 'Lint'
# @api private
LINT_REDUNDANT_DIRECTIVE_COP = "#{LINT_DEPARTMENT}/RedundantCopDisableDirective"
# @api private
LINT_SYNTAX_COP = "#{LINT_DEPARTMENT}/Syntax"
# @api private
COP_NAME_PATTERN = '([A-Z]\w+/)*(?:[A-Z]\w+)'
# @api private
COP_NAMES_PATTERN = "(?:#{COP_NAME_PATTERN} , )*#{COP_NAME_PATTERN}"
# @api private
COPS_PATTERN = "(all|#{COP_NAMES_PATTERN})"
# @api private
DIRECTIVE_COMMENT_REGEXP = Regexp.new(
"# rubocop : ((?:disable|enable|todo))\\b #{COPS_PATTERN}"
.gsub(' ', '\s*')
)
def self.before_comment(line)
line.split(DIRECTIVE_COMMENT_REGEXP).first
end
attr_reader :comment, :cop_registry, :mode, :cops
def initialize(comment, cop_registry = Cop::Registry.global)
@comment = comment
@cop_registry = cop_registry
@mode, @cops = match_captures
end
# Checks if this directive relates to single line
def single_line?
!comment.text.start_with?(DIRECTIVE_COMMENT_REGEXP)
end
# Checks if this directive contains all the given cop names
def match?(cop_names)
parsed_cop_names.uniq.sort == cop_names.uniq.sort
end
def range
match = comment.text.match(DIRECTIVE_COMMENT_REGEXP)
begin_pos = comment.source_range.begin_pos
Parser::Source::Range.new(
comment.source_range.source_buffer, begin_pos + match.begin(0), begin_pos + match.end(0)
)
end
# Returns match captures to directive comment pattern
def match_captures
@match_captures ||= comment.text.match(DIRECTIVE_COMMENT_REGEXP)&.captures
end
# Checks if this directive disables cops
def disabled?
%w[disable todo].include?(mode)
end
# Checks if this directive enables cops
def enabled?
mode == 'enable'
end
# Checks if this directive enables all cops
def enabled_all?
!disabled? && all_cops?
end
# Checks if this directive disables all cops
def disabled_all?
disabled? && all_cops?
end
# Checks if all cops specified in this directive
def all_cops?
cops == 'all'
end
# Returns array of specified in this directive cop names
def cop_names
@cop_names ||= all_cops? ? all_cop_names : parsed_cop_names
end
# Returns array of specified in this directive department names
# when all department disabled
def department_names
splitted_cops_string.select { |cop| department?(cop) }
end
# Checks if directive departments include cop
def in_directive_department?(cop)
department_names.any? { |department| cop.start_with?(department) }
end
# Checks if cop department has already used in directive comment
def overridden_by_department?(cop)
in_directive_department?(cop) && splitted_cops_string.include?(cop)
end
def directive_count
splitted_cops_string.count
end
# Returns line number for directive
def line_number
comment.source_range.line
end
private
def splitted_cops_string
(cops || '').split(/,\s*/)
end
def parsed_cop_names
cops = splitted_cops_string.map do |name|
department?(name) ? cop_names_for_department(name) : name
end.flatten
cops - [LINT_SYNTAX_COP]
end
def department?(name)
cop_registry.department?(name)
end
def all_cop_names
exclude_lint_department_cops(cop_registry.names)
end
def cop_names_for_department(department)
names = cop_registry.names_for_department(department)
department == LINT_DEPARTMENT ? exclude_lint_department_cops(names) : names
end
def exclude_lint_department_cops(cops)
cops - [LINT_REDUNDANT_DIRECTIVE_COP, LINT_SYNTAX_COP]
end
end
end
